Manjaf - Jakhanikhal, Pauri Garhwal

Manjaf is a village situated in the Jakhanikhal tehsil of Pauri Garhwal district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 46 km from Lansdowne and around 61 km from Pauri. Nairul serves as the Gram Panchayat for Manjaf village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Manjaf is 047241. The village covers a total geographical area of 113.35 hectares and falls under the 246123 pincode. Lansdowne is the nearest town, located about 46 km away.

Manjaf village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Manjaf

As per Census 2011, Manjaf village has a total population of 35 people, consisting of 14 males and 21 females. The village has 8 households and a sex ratio of 1,500 females per 1,000 males. There are 4 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 23 literate and 12 illiterate residents. Additionally, 19 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Manjaf

Public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the Manjaf. The nearest railway station is Rishikesh, while the nearest airport is Dehradun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 38.6 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Lansdowne to Manjaf is about 46 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.3 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Pauri to Manjaf is about 61 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.7 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
